North Gaston was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their third straight loss. They lost 9-0 to the Forestview Jaguars. While losing is never fun, North Gaston can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' North Carolina soccer rankings (they are ranked 452nd, while Forestview is ranked 132nd).
North Gaston's defeat dropped their record down to 3-16-1. As for Forestview, they have been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four contests, which provided a nice bump to their 11-4-2 record this season.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. North Gaston will take on Kings Mountain at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Forestview, they will be playing at home against Stuart W. Cramer at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. Forestview will be looking to keep their four-game home win streak alive.
